About the role

The MRI Technologist performs routine and advanced MRI procedures to produce high-quality diagnostic images while ensuring patient safety and comfort. They are also responsible for maintaining equipment, documenting exams in the EMR, and providing on-call coverage for the radiology department.

SUMMARY

As an MRI Technologist, your ability to empathize with patients, specialized technical skills, and dedication to quality greatly enhance the overall success of MRI imaging for diagnostic use in patient care in RRH Radiology. Performs technical and specialized skills in the operation of a Magnetic Resonance (MRI) Scanner to produce high-quality cross-sectional images for diagnostic purposes, while providing maximum comfort and safety to patients undergoing these procedures.

Responsibilities

  • Performs a variety of routine and advanced MRI (magnetic resonance imaging) procedures in the presence of a strong magnetic field while monitoring and maintaining essential patient care and safety.
  • Educates patients regarding their procedure and maintains a safe, comfortable, and supportive environment for the patient throughout the exam.
  • Maintains accountability for timely and proper service to patients during unsupervised shifts.
  • Provides on-call coverage for the MRI Section of Radiology.
  • Maintains accountability for proper documentation of exams and related procedures utilizing the Radiant Care Connect EMR.
  • Cleans, restocks, and prepares rooms on a daily basis.
  • Provides excellent customer service.
  • Verify patient identification and order/requisition; utilizing clinical indications to assess the appropriateness of procedure and consulting with the provider/radiologist for order verification, as needed.
  • Administers IV contrast media (they must also be competency assessed on orientation and/or annually).
  • Trained in PACS software and transfers imaging data for archiving and post-data processing.
  • Follows direct orders from the radiologist or referring provider for MRI imaging and contrast administration via protocol.
  • Receives verbal orders and documents appropriately in the EMR.
  • Collaborates with all modalities for mutual patient flow.
  • Performs transport duties as needed.
  • Monitor patient status; notify nurse/physician of patient condition.
  • Appropriately maintains all MRI and accessory equipment.
  • All other duties as assigned.

Required qualifications

  • A.A.S. in Radiologic Technology or completion of a Radiologic Technology hospital certificate program
  • NYS license in Radiologic Technology required OR must hold NYS permit and obtain licensure within six months of hire.
  • American Registry of Radiologic Technologists Certification (ARRT-R) is required within 6 months of employment.
  • NYS Injection Certification within 6 months of employment.
  • BLS Certification within 6 months of employment.

Market context

New York radiologic technologist roles stay competitive

In New York, allied health employers commonly look for radiologic technologists with ARRT certification and a New York State license or temporary permit, and experience is often preferred. These roles can be competitive because facilities want candidates who can start safely and work efficiently in fast-paced imaging settings.
